Monitoring method and principle of dissolved oxygen analyzer for water quality

Jul 03, 2024

Monitoring method and principle of dissolved oxygen analyzer for water quality

 

Dissolved oxygen detection is a very important indicator for water quality testing. The application of dissolved oxygen meters includes water environment monitoring, fisheries, wastewater discharge control, and laboratory detection of BOD. The large screen display screen of the water quality dissolved oxygen detector can display the detection results in mg/l units or air saturation percentage, and also display the temperature. Instruments controlled by microprocessors provide advanced dissolved oxygen detection technology.


The measurement methods and principles used in water quality dissolved oxygen meters are as follows:


1. Membrane method (also known as polarography or constant pressure method)
The measurement principle of dissolved oxygen analyzer is that the solubility of oxygen in water depends on temperature, pressure, and the salts dissolved in water. The sensing part of the dissolved oxygen analyzer is composed of a gold electrode (cathode) and a silver electrode (anode), as well as an electrolyte of methyl chloride or potassium hydroxide. Oxygen diffuses through the membrane and enters the electrolyte, forming a measurement circuit with the gold electrode and silver electrode. When a polarization voltage of 0, 6-0, or 8V is applied to the electrode of the dissolved oxygen analyzer, oxygen diffuses through the membrane, the cathode releases electrons, and the anode receives electrons, generating a current. The entire reaction process is as follows: anode Ag+Cl → AgCl+2e - cathode O2+2H2O+4e → 4OH - According to Faraday's law, the current flowing through the electrode of the dissolved oxygen analyzer is proportional to the oxygen partial pressure, and there is a linear relationship between the current and oxygen concentration under constant temperature.


2. Fluorescence method
The fluorescence probe is equipped with a built-in light source, which emits blue light to illuminate the fluorescence layer. The fluorescent substance is excited and emits red light. Due to the quenching effect of oxygen molecules, the time and intensity of the excited red light are inversely proportional to the concentration of oxygen molecules. By measuring the phase difference between the excited red light and the reference light, and comparing it with the internal calibration value, the concentration of oxygen molecules can be calculated. No oxygen consumption during measurement, stable data, reliable performance, and no interference.
